1. Lima aktivitas sistem operasi yang merupakan contoh dari suatu managemen proses.
· Pembuatan dan penghapusan proses pengguna dan sistem proses.
· Menunda atau melanjutkan proses.
· Menyediakan mekanisme untuk proses sinkronisasi.
· Menyediakan mekanisme untuk proses komunikasi.
· Menyediakan mekanisme untuk penanganan deadlock.
2. Perbedaan antara penjadwalan short term, medium term dan long term.
Short term scheduler
· Short term scheduler digunakan untuk memilih diantara proses-proses yang siap di eksekusi dan salah satunya dialokasikan ke CPU.
· Short term scheduler Sering digunakan untuk memilih proses baru untuk CPU. Proses dieksekusi hanya beberapa milidetik sebelum menunggu I/O.
· Karena durasi yang pendek antara eksekusi, Short term scheduler harus sangat cepat
Contoh : jika Short term scheduler membutuhkan 10ms untuk memutuskan mengeksekusi proses 100ms, maka 10/110=9% CPU digunakan untuk menjadwalkan pekerjaan.
· Pada system time sharing, setiap proses baru ditempatkan di memori. Short term scheduler digunakan untuk memilih dari proses-proses tersebut di memori untuk diekseskusi.